Common Causes of High CPU Usage and How to Prevent Them
Category: Troubleshooting
High CPU usage can drastically reduce your computer’s performance, making it slow and unresponsive. Whether you’re on Windows, Mac, or Linux, understanding the root causes of high CPU usage is essential for maintaining a smooth and efficient system. In this article, we’ll cover the most common causes and provide practical solutions to prevent CPU overload.
1. Background Processes
Many background applications running simultaneously can consume significant CPU resources.
How to Identify Background Processes:
1. Press Ctrl + Shift + Esc to open Task Manager.
2. Go to the Processes tab.
3. Sort by CPU usage to identify resource-hungry processes.
4. Right-click and select End task if necessary.
2. Outdated Drivers
Drivers that are not up-to-date can cause conflicts, leading to increased CPU usage.
Updating Drivers on Windows:
1. Open Device Manager (Win + X).
2. Expand the hardware category, right-click the device, and select Update driver.
3. Choose Search automatically for updated driver software.
3. Malware and Viruses
Malicious software can hijack your system’s resources, causing severe performance drops.
- Run a full system scan using Windows Defender or a reputable antivirus.
- Remove or quarantine detected threats immediately.
- Consider using tools like Malwarebytes for comprehensive scanning.
4. Too Many Startup Programs
Startup programs can overload the CPU during boot-up, making the system sluggish.
1. Open Task Manager (Ctrl + Shift + Esc).
2. Go to the Startup tab.
3. Disable unnecessary programs from launching at startup.
5. Resource-Intensive Applications
Programs like video editors or games can max out CPU usage.
- Close non-essential applications before running demanding programs.
- Lower the graphics settings in games to reduce CPU strain.
6. Corrupt System Files
Damaged or corrupted system files can cause high CPU usage as Windows attempts to resolve errors.
1. Open Command Prompt as Administrator.
2. Run: sfc /scannow
3. Let the scan complete and follow the on-screen instructions.
7. Windows Update Problems
Pending or stuck updates can cause constant CPU activity.
1. Open Settings > Update & Security > Windows Update.
2. Check for updates and install pending ones.
3. Restart your computer if required.
8. Inefficient Power Settings
Balanced or power-saving modes can throttle CPU performance.
1. Open Control Panel > Power Options.
2. Select High Performance to maximize CPU power.
9. High CPU Usage from Browser Tabs
Browsers with many open tabs can heavily tax your CPU.
- Close unnecessary tabs and extensions.
- Use Task Manager within the browser to see which tabs are consuming the most resources.
10. Hardware Issues
Faulty cooling systems or outdated hardware can cause overheating and CPU throttling.
- Clean dust from cooling fans and vents.
- Consider upgrading to a more powerful CPU or adding more RAM.
Conclusion
High CPU usage can result from various factors, including background processes, outdated drivers, malware, and hardware issues. By following these troubleshooting tips and preventive measures, you can maintain optimal CPU performance and avoid slowdowns.
For more troubleshooting tips and guides, visit Microsoft Support.